直接抛出问题的解决方案[Vmware-esx版本5.0/6.x都适用]
Vmware-esx 检测raid和硬盘状态的三种方法:
1、官方的vmware-esx-provider-lsiprovider.vib(可以查看硬盘联机在线情况但不能查询具体健康)
2、戴尔(包括其他品牌服务器)的raid卡控制器管理软件或者官方提供IPMI硬件接口开发 (有实力公司可以这样做)
3、第三方工具例如MegaRAID Storage Manager (笔者推荐,简单命令安装,然后脚本任务计划即可)
安装第三方provider,可查看RAID健康状态
由于VMware发布ESXi5.0后,将以往版本中在健康状况-传感器里可以看到的RAID卡及其硬盘状态的功能取消了所有第三方的provider,ESXi5是不能查看磁盘状态的,这个就很麻烦,我们不能在线检查阵列里有没有掉盘。需要的话,得自己安装自己RAID卡对应的cim provider,方可看到RAID卡及其硬盘的状态。
DELL R420的机器插H310的卡装完ESXi5.1是不能查看磁盘状态的,这个就很麻烦,我们不能在线检查阵列里有没有掉盘。
缺的就是下图中存储器一项
2013-9-12 14:33 上传
解决起来也很简单
1、下载vmware-esx-provider-lsiprovider.vib
2、上传安装这玩意儿
3、重启
vmware-esx-provider-lsiprovider.vib的下载地址:http://www.lsi.com/Pages/user/eula.aspx?file=http%3a%2f%2fwww.lsi.com%2fdownloads%2fPublic%2fMegaRAID%2520Common%2520Files%2f00.03.V0.03_SMIS_VMware_Installer.zip&Source=http%3a%2f%2fwww.lsi.com%2fdownloads
上传工具:WinSCP 下载地址:http://jaist.dl.sourceforge.net/project/winscp/WinSCP/5.1.7/winscp
安装用的操作界面:putty 中文版下载地址:http://code.google.com/p/puttycn/downloads/detail?name=puttyfile_0.63cn.zip&can=2&q=
下载完后全部解压备用
首先在ESXi上启用SSH
其次用WinSCP连接ESXi 将vmware-esx-provider-lsiprovider.vib上传至 /tmp目录下
安装vmware-esx-provider-lsiprovider.vib
在VMware vSphere Client关闭所有虚机,右键宿主进入维护模式
这回轮到tuppy
等到执行完成
重启宿主,大功告成
【更多详细图文ΦΨ↓Φ↓↓】
VMware查看RAID健康 https://wenku.baidu.com/view/41405dbe3086bceb19e8b8f67c1cfad6195fe9bf.html